#db3712 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#db3712 is composed of 85.9% red, 21.6%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.9% magenta, 91.8%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 11 degrees, a saturation of 84.8% and a lightness of 46.5%. #db3712 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6e24 with #b70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#db3712 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#db3712 has RGB values of R:219, G:55,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.92,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14366482.

Hex triplet db3712 #db3712
RGB Decimal 219, 55, 18 rgb(219,55,18)
RGB Percent 85.9, 21.6, 7.1 rgb(85.9%,21.6%,7.1%)
CMYK 0, 75, 92, 14
HSL 11°, 84.8, 46.5 hsl(11,84.8%,46.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 11°, 91.8, 85.9
Web Safe cc3300 #cc3300
CIE-LAB 49.301, 61.553, 56.514
XYZ 30.69, 17.84, 2.4
xyY 0.603, 0.35, 17.84
CIE-LCH 49.301, 83.562, 42.556
CIE-LUV 49.301, 130.756, 36.69
Hunter-Lab 42.237, 55.786, 26.198
Binary 11011011, 00110111, 00010010

Shades and Tints of #db3712

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fef1ee is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#db3712 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#646464 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#7c5b54 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8a7c2c Protanopia 1% of men
  • #9b7600 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#dd3e3f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a76322 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b25f06 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#dc3b2f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
